55+ Communities, also called 55 Plus Communities, are active retirement havens for adults, offering varied amenities and housing from golf course homes to serene city living among like-minded neighbors. They typically include pools, Pickleball, Shuffleboard, tennis courts, clubhouses with kitchens, and championship golf courses in gated, resort-like environments.

Maryland may be one of the smallest states in the US, but for those seeking to retire, it is large in comparison to many other states.

Maryland touches three major bodies of water—the Chesapeake Bay, the Potomac River and Atlantic Ocean. With about 4,000 miles of shoreline, 400 lakes and dozens of rivers and creeks, there are pl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y. Many locals like to go boating, canoeing and kayaking.

Mild weather and vast entertainment opportunities make Maryland both an exciting and peaceful place to retire.
